To the RPC Planning Committee: Wednesday morning, when the calendar committee debriefed, we all regretted that our larger group did not have an opportunity to talk about the ideas that were put forward by our speakers. The calendar committee had a rich discussion — and we wish you all had been a part of it! So, we decided to invite you to comment in this virtual space.
To start, let me share some of the thoughts that were offered in our debrief:
When Kirsten & Jeremy talked about liking the structure that their church provides, we were reminded of the overwhelming array of options we all face, in media, in entertainment, in lifestyle choices, as consumers. In such a rich and confusing marketplace of ideas, structure can be very comforting and provide great security.
Likewise, in a society that may seem out of control, the need for practical advise on how to live life, how to manage a marriage, can be great.
We need to recognize that “church happens” in a mot of different ways and places, not just in a sactuary at 11 a.m. on Sunday. Church happens on a youth trip, in a gathering of young aduilts at a restaurant, and sometimes those who participate in THAT form of “church” are not participating in Sunday morning worship.
